Please Support Us, By White-Listing/Unblock us from your Ads-Block Programs so We Could keep Run This site For Free. We Promise that Our Advertisement Never Block Your Ways. Thank You So Much !!!
If you are a Linux or UNIX user, you must know some useful commands that can be used in the operating system. One of the most used commands for Linux and UNIX is the chmod command. Chmod stands for change mode which is what the command does. It is used to change the permissions of the files and directories in your system. The usage of the command is quite simple and the syntax is as follows:
chmod options permissions filename
You can put the necessary information in this syntax and you can change the https://www.myseotools.co.uk/blog/chmod-calculator-chmod-permission-and-chmod-sample.phpfile permissions. All of syntax must be written in short forms so that the operating system understands it. Suppose if you want a file such that the current user can read, write and execute it, members of groups can read and execute it and others may only read it, the following command shall be written:
chmod u=rwx, g=rx, o=r myfile
As you now know, the chmod command is used to change file permissions, the technicalities behind it will explain the function in a better way. When you execute the chmod command, the file mode for every specified file is changed. Usually, they are symbolic representations or octal numbers which indicate the bit pattern.
There are combinations of letters that can be used to execute a command just like we saw earlier in an example. Even numbers are used for the same purpose. There are few set letters and numbers that allow you to write the command and it is necessary for you to know about them.
Every time you write the chmod command, it preserves the directory's setuid and setgid. But if you specifically ask it not to, it won't preserve the ids. There are two different modes alphabetic and numerals and you can use any of them to get your desired result.
Now we all must have imagined that couldn’t someone who is unauthorized can change the file type or mode? With the help of Restricted Deletion Flag, no one can change the file type and permissions unless they own that file. This is a sorted way to manage the whole system securely and efficiently. There are some world writable directories such as the /temp file we all have in our systems and it is used in them. There is also something known as the sticky bit which stores important data so that it loads quickly when opened again.
Following are some examples of how the command can be used in various circumstances:
chmod u+s file.txt
When you write this command, you are setting the user id for the file so that everyone can access it as if they are the owner.
chmod 666 file.txt
The above command can set the permissions as read and write by everyone. This is a useful shortcut to know.
Chown – You can change the ownership of files through this command.
Ls – A popular command which lists all the directories and files in a system.